I had a conquest HD 5-25 on my target rig back a few years. Nice scope for sure.For years now, I’d upgrade a couple rifle scopes here and there and mount the old ones on smaller rifles like the 10-22, 22-250, or maybe they were a bit better on one of the boys’ rifles. Zeiss and Sworovski were always out of my price range, but when Zeiss came out with the Conquest series for $470 I had to try it. Unbelievable clarity and brightness during low-light situations. It blew away similarly priced optics. But last I looked they had doubled in price.
My oldest boy just bought a pair of Vortex 10x42 binocs and they seem to be of very fine quality as well. I’ll probably try a Vortex scope next time I have a rifle in need of one
